No child codes; this is a class-level code.
- funding and administration of government-provided social security programmes, e.g.:
- sickness, work-accident and unemployment insurance
- retirement pensions
- covering losses of income due to parental leave, temporary disablement, widowhood / loss of partner
- complementary or supplementary health insurance, see 65.12
- provision of retirement income benefits exclusively for the sponsor’s employees or members, see 65.30
- administration of healthcare and social services, see 84.12
- provision of residential care assistance services, see division 87

Rev. 2 code 84.30 maps to the same Rev. 2.1 class 84.30 Compulsory social security activities.
Official close match imported from NACE Rev. 2.1.
Low operational impact is expected, but systems should still store the target Rev. 2.1 version explicitly.
Confirm the target version field and update references where Rev. 2.1 is required.
